<p>New Delhi: Indian and Chinese negotiators have reached an agreement on patrolling along the Line of Actual Control (LAC) in eastern Ladakh, Foreign Secretary Vikram Misri said on Monday.</p><p>The foreign secretary said the Indian and Chinese negotiators were in touch over the last few weeks to resolve the remaining issues.</p>.Indian Army to open museum to counter China's claims on Arunachal Pradesh.<p>It is understood that the agreement pertains to patrolling in Depsang and Demchok areas.</p><p>The announcement on the breakthrough comes a day ahead of Prime Minister Narendra Modi's travel to the Russian city of Kazan to attend the BRICS Summit.</p><p>Though there is no official announcement, it is expected that Modi and Chinese President Xi Jinping will hold a bilateral meeting on the sidelines of the BRICS Summit.</p>
